Moschino presents its latest Spring/Summer 2024 Womenswear collection. To celebrate Moschino’s 40th anniversary,”40 years of love”, four friends of the House were asked to create a collection inspired by Franco Moschino’s iconic designs from 1983 to 1993.
Looking ahead, not backwards – the only way that mattered to him.
Four celebrated stylists, four extraordinary women, four acts of the same play composed by Carlyne Cerf de Dudzeele, Gabriella Karefa-Johnson, Lucia Liu and Katie Grand.

Dubai Fashion Week (DFW), founded by Dubai Design District (d3), part of TECOM Group PJSC, and the Arab Fashion Council (AFC), will return from 9 October until 15 October 2023 at d3. The upcoming event will present Spring/Summer 24 collections and include a dynamic, citywide calendar of high-profile fashion shows, exclusive events, book signing, a trunk show in collaboration with Mall of the Emirates, capsule launches, brand activations and industry talks.
